Rel Canonical question
-
Hi:
I got a report indication 17 rel canonical notices. What does this mean in simple language and how do i go about fixing things?
-
Thanks guys!
-
Also, it's just a notice, not a warning or error. More of a "hey, this is here and make sure everything looks OK" type of thing.
-
Did you not add these yourself? It is a single line of code on the pages of your site:
If the rel=canonical is exactly the same as the URL of the page it is one then don't panic everything is fine :). If the URL in the rel=canonical tag is different than the URL of the page it is on, you may need to change it. Rel=canonical means, in as simple language as I can put it:
Google, Bing, or Whoever shows up to your page. Rel=canonical says,"Hey! Google, Bing, or Whoever! I'd prefer it if you would look at this other page as the "definitive" version of this content." And then rel=canonical points the search engine to the other page. After this, the non-"canonical" page should drop out of the search results.
This is useful when:
1. You have two pages with very similar or duplicate content that you want users to be able to navigate to, but that you don't want Google to see as duplicate (they get very angry about that now). These could be on one domain, or on two different website that you run.
2. You have URLs that are dynamically generated, or have a lot of query strings (e.g., ?shoes=red), and you don't want Google to think that you are duplicating content.
3. Someone else takes your content and tries to pass it off as their own.
Many people (myself included) feel that you should have "self-serving" rel=canonical on every page of your site, where the URL is the same as the page it is on. This helps with number 3, since you are automatically telling Google "Hey, THIS is the definitive version" before anyone else has the chance to.
If the rel=canonical tags are pointing to pages that they shouldn't be pointing to, you just need to delete that one line of code.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Meta Data Question
Hi There, I am working on the umbraco CMS and we have a Menu page which sits under one page on the CMS. When accessing this page on the front end and navigating between the food menu / drinks menu, the url changes depending on which content you are on, however i have only one place to input a meta title and description meaning that it is seeing them as duplicate content as both the drinks menu url and food menu url are showing the same meta data. Hopefully this makes sense, does anyone have anything similair where a url change happens when content within the page changes.
Technical SEO | | AlexStanleyGK0 -
301 redirect homepage question
Hi If i have a homepage which is available at both www.homepage.com and www.homepage.com// should i 301 the // version to the first version. Im curious as to whether slashes are taking into consideration Thanks in advance
Technical SEO | | TheZenAgency0 -
Basic Redirection Question
I am doing a 301 Redirect from site ABC to site XYZ. I loaded the following .htaccess file by ftp to the ABC.com/ server: Redirect 301 / http://XYZ.com/ This was completed over 30 days ago, OSE is not showing any of the links and is failing to show that abc.com is redirected even though the MozBar shows a successful 301 http status code. Is this still just a waiting game or is it not advised to do a redirect this way for seo? PS: ahrefs is showing the redirect itself, however, it is not showing the links going to site ABC.com/ as passing to site XYZ.com/ . Any help is appreciated.
Technical SEO | | Vspeed0 -
Canonical URL
I previously set the canonical Url in google web masters to the non www version, when I check my on page opt, it tells me that I have a critical issue with this. Should I change it in google web masters back to the www version? if so is there the possibility of negative results? Or is there a better way to deal with this? Note, I have inbound links pointing to both types.
Technical SEO | | bronxpad0 -
Technical question about site structure using a CMS, redirects, and canonical tag
I have a couple of sites using a particular CMS that creates all of the pages under a content folder, including the home page. So the url is www.example.com/content/default.asp. There is a default.asp in the root directory that redirects to the default page in the content folder using a response.redirect statement and it’s considered a 302 redirect. So all incoming urls, i.e. www.example.com and example.com and www.example.com/ will go to the default.asp which then redirects to www.example.com/ content/default.asp. How does this affect SEO? Should the redirect be a 301? And whether it’s a 301 or a 302, can we have a rel=canonical tag on the page that that is rel=www.example.com? Or does that create some sort of loop? I’ve inherited several sites that use this CMS and need to figure out the best way to handle it.
Technical SEO | | CHutchins1 -
Robots.txt question
What is this robots.txt telling the search engines? User-agent: * Disallow: /stats/
Technical SEO | | DenverKelly0 -
Question about domain redirects
One of my clients has an odd domain redirect situation. See if you can get your head round this: Domain A is set-up as a domain alias of Domain B Entering domain A or domain B takes you to default.asp on domain B. The default.asp includes VB script to check the HTTP_HOST variable. It checks whether the main doman name for domain A is present in the HTTP_HOST and if so redirects it to domain A/sub-folder/index.htm. If not present it redirects to domain B/index.htm. In both cases the redirect uses a response.Redirect clause. I think what is trying to be achieved is to redirect requests to Domain A to a sub-folder of Domain B. It works but seems extremely convoluted. Can anyone see problems with this set-up? Will link juice be lost along the redirect paths?
Technical SEO | | bjalc20110 -
Confused about rel="canonical"
I'm receiving a duplicate content error in my reports for www.example.com and www.example.com/index.htm. Should I put the rel="canonical" on the index page and point it to www.example.com? And if I have other important pages where rel="canonical" is being suggested do I place the rel="canonical" on that page? For example if www.example/product is an important page would I place on that page?
Technical SEO | | BrandonC-2698870